/**
* CSRF attacks (where a malicious website uses frames, <img> tags, or
* similar, to prompt a wiki user to open a wiki page or submit a form,
* without being aware of doing so) are most easily countered by using
* tokens. For normal browsing, loading the form for a protected action
* sets two copies of a random string: one in the $_SESSION, and one as
* a hidden field in the form. When the form is submitted, it checks
* that a) the set of cookies submitted with the form *has* a copy of
* the session cookie, and b) that it matches. Since malicious websites
* don't have control over the session cookies, they can't craft a form
* that can be instantly submitted which will have the appropriate tokens.
*
* Note that these tokens are distinct from those in User::setToken(), which
* are used for persistent session authentication and are retained for as
* long as the user is logged in to the wiki. These tokens are to protect
* one individual action, and should ideally be cleared once the action is over.
*/
class Token {
/*
* Some punctuation to prevent editing from broken
* text-mangling proxies.
*/
const TOKEN_SUFFIX = '+\\';
/**
* Different tokens for different types of action.
*
* We don't store tokens for some actions for anons
* so they can still do things when they have cookies disabled.
* So either use this for actions which anons can't access, or
* where you don't mind an attacker being able to trigger the action
* anonymously from the user's IP. However, the token is still
* useful because it fails with some broken proxies.
*/
const ANONYMOUS = 'Edit';
/**
* For actions requiring a medium level of protection, or where the
* user will be making repeated actions: this token should not be
* cleared once the action is completed. For instance, a user might
* revert mass vandalism from a user by loading their contribs and
* ctrl+clicking each rollback link. If we cleared the Token from
* session after each rollback, they'd have to reload the contribs
* page each time, which would be annoying.
*/
const PERSISTENT = 'Action';
/**
* For actions requiring a high level of protection, and where the user
* will not be performing multiple sequential actions without reloading
* the form or link. Eg login, block/protect/delete, userrights, etc.
* Callers should clear these tokens upon completion of the action, and
* other callers should expect that they will be cleared.
*/
const UNIQUE = 'Unique';
/**
* String the action which is being protected by the token
* ('edit', 'login', 'rollback', etc)
*/
protected $type = self::ANONYMOUS;
/**
* An instance-specific salt. So if you want to generate a hundred rollback
* tokens for the watchlist, pass a $salt which is unique
* to each revision. Only one token is stored in the session, but it is munged
* with a different salt for each revision, so the required value in the HTML
* is different for each case.
*/
protected $salt = '';
